Stair skirting, an often overlooked element in home design, plays a crucial role in both aesthetics and functionality. This essential feature is not just about covering the gaps between the stairs and walls but is a statement of style and an aspect of safety. With years of expertise in interior design and architecture, understanding the core elements of stair skirting can enhance your living space's value, appearance, and safety.

stair skirting

First and foremost, stair skirting contributes to the overall aesthetic appeal of your home. By providing a clean and finished look, it seamlessly integrates the stairs with the rest of your home’s decor. Whether your style leans towards modern minimalism, rustic charm, or traditional elegance, there is a stair skirting option to complement and enhance your existing design. Materials range from classic wood, which offers warmth and natural beauty, to contemporary materials like metal or MDF, which provide sleek lines and modern flair. Selecting the right material is essential, not just for aesthetics, but also for durability and maintenance. Skirting boards on stairs are not just about looks. They play a key role in protecting walls from damage. In high-traffic areas such as staircases, walls can easily become scuffed or scratched by shoes, vacuum cleaners, or other objects. A well-installed stair skirting board acts as a barrier, keeping your walls pristine and reducing the need for frequent maintenance or repairs. It also offers a simpler way to keep your stairs looking fresh and clean, as the surface of a skirting board is often easier to clean than the surrounding wall.

Beyond aesthetics and protection, stair skirting is crucial for safety. It helps to define the boundaries between stairs and walls, providing a clear visual separation that can prevent accidents. This is especially important for individuals with impaired vision or mobility concerns. By highlighting each step and the edge of the staircase, it reduces the risk of trips and falls, making it an invaluable safety feature in any multi-level home.stair skirting
When it comes to installation, expertise is vital. Poorly installed skirting can detract from the look of your home rather than enhance it. For those considering DIY, be prepared for careful measurement and precision cutting to ensure each piece fits perfectly without gaps or misalignments. However, the best results often come from hiring professionals who bring experience and craftsmanship to the job. They ensure that the skirting is not only aesthetically pleasing but also securely fitted to withstand the daily wear and tear of an active household. In terms of style and design, the options are virtually limitless. The height of your skirting can dramatically alter the perception of your staircase. A higher skirting board may offer a more traditional feel, while a lower profile can add to a contemporary look. Adding decorative features like beveling or molding can further enhance its appeal, turning a simple stair into a focal point of architectural interest. To ensure long-term satisfaction, selecting quality materials is crucial. Hardwood options, while initially more expensive, offer superior durability and a timeless appeal that can enhance the value of your home. Alternatively, engineered wood or composite materials can offer similar aesthetics with added resilience against moisture and pests, making them suitable for varied climates and conditions.
